Web7 jul. 2024 · Painting fabric not only allows you to create your own beautiful art, but it also allows you to customize your clothes, upholstery fabric, and any other crafts involving … Web22 feb. 2024 · Use an iron to heat set the paint on the fabric. Do not use any steam settings on your iron, as you want dry heat applied to the paint. Empty the water container on your iron and switch off any steam settings. Iron on the wrong side of your fabric, and avoid ironing directly on the painted side.

Web12 dec. 2024 · Wet prewashed fabric with warm water and add to the dye mixture. Using a metal spoon, stir constantly for ten to 30 minutes depending upon the level of color desired. Try to prevent twisting the fabric which can cause uneven dyeing. You may want to dip the fabric up and down to keep it untangled.
